Indian cable producers operating under government infrastructure projects demand high line speeds. China-made rod breakdown machines support drawing speeds exceeding 25 m/s, offering massive volume advantages that match local targets for electrification and smart grids.
Integration of HMI touchscreen panels and programmable PLC units (such as Siemens or Mitsubishi) allows manufacturers to maintain tight controls on wire elongation, tension feedback, and thermal annealing, minimizing copper breakages significantly.
Utilizing high-tensile carbon steel, seamless columns, and heat-treated cast frames ensures the machinery withstands persistent vibration. Leveraging premium raw steel supply chains from leading producers provides the foundation for machinery designed to last 20+ years.
How industrial steel integration guarantees high performance in demanding industrial conditions.
The heavy base plates and drawing cabinets of high-speed copper drawing equipment require robust metallurgical properties to survive cyclic loading stresses.
Drawing capstans coated with tungsten carbide over structural carbon steel substrates minimize frictional wear when reducing 8mm rods down to fine wire gauges.
Inner emulsion chambers utilize stainless steel linings or specialized galvanized barriers to resist high-temperature lubricants and chemical emulsions.
Heavy helical gears and multi-axis drives depend on ASTM-standard seamless aluminum tubes and carbon-alloy steel bar stocks to manage high torque distributions.
Navigating regional engineering standards, electrical grid realities, and local support infrastructures.
Industrial power grids across regions like Gujarat, Maharashtra, and Tamil Nadu occasionally experience power fluctuations. China-based exporters adapt their machines with localized variable frequency drives (VFD) and voltage stabilizing coils to operate safely at 415V, 50Hz, 3-phase systems.
Ensuring compliance with local Indian standards (like IS 694 and IS 1554) is essential. Machine parameters are factory-calibrated to draw copper wires that strictly match the elongation, resistance limits, and structural tensile values mandated by BIS inspectorates.
Through established logistics hubs, buyers access immediate replacements for high-wear parts like ceramic-coated pulleys, diamond drawing dies, and carbon brushes, avoiding extended operational downtime.

How industry leaders plan operations based on digital intelligence and energy-saving architectures.
Modern copper wire makers utilize cloud-linked sensors to track motor heat, lubrication quality, and bearing wear. Operators receive alerts before issues occur, drastically decreasing unplanned downtime.
Continuous annealers reduce electrical usage through nitrogen or steam protection zones. This process keeps wires soft and oxidation-free with minimal energy waste, supporting environmental goals.
Automatic dual-spool take-ups allow continuous operation during spool changes. The system switches spools at high speeds without pausing, maintaining high wire quality throughout the run.
Targeted machinery alignments matching specific regional market needs within the Indian Subcontinent.
Focuses on drawing heavy 8mm copper rods down to 1.2mm - 3.5mm conductors. Essential for overhead transmission lines, regional utility installations, and underground power grids under national modernization plans.
Employs high-speed multi-wire drawing systems to yield consistent, fine 0.1mm - 0.4mm copper wires. These feed manufacturing facilities in industrial corridors like Chennai, Pune, and Haryana.
Supplies robust, PVC-coated house wires matching domestic safety requirements. The systems run smoothly with extrusion lines, boosting production speeds for residential cables.
